Having a 'Ball' Leads to Fun for Children with Special Needs
Announcing the Second Annual Fundraising Event for Lekotek on Friday, October 21, 2011 in Chicago to Raise Money for Special Needs Children.

CHICAGO, IL, October 07, 2011 /24-7PressRelease/ -- The Lekotek Ambassadors, a group of young professionals in Chicago who fundraise for the National Lekotek Center are hosting a Ball at the Metropolitan Club. The event, entitled Soaring Above the Skyline, will take place on Friday, October 21, on the 66th floor of Willis Towers above Chicago's incredible skyline.

Dining and dancing along with live music, artisan cocktails and the thrill of a luxurious silent auction will fill the evening. Tickets sales, corporate & personal sponsors and donations will fill the lives of children with disabilities with the opportunities to participate in the National Lekotek Center's therapeutic play programs.

Lekotek promotes play as a highly effective way to encourage growth, development and learning. "Children learn more through play because it's fun, self-motivated and stimulating. The basis of every child life begins with play and we all need that opportunity." says Macy Welsh, Director of the National Lekotek Center. "We are so grateful for the Lekotek Ambassadors, who give their time to fundraise so more children with disabilities will be sponsored into Lekotek programs."

This is the second year for the Ambassador Ball and the members have worked hard to get the word out about this worthy event. Megan Cleary, co-chairman of Lekotek Ambassador Group shares with donors and sponsors how her involvement has personally motivated her. "Knowing how truly exceptional children and families with special needs are and seeing some of the daily struggles they face, we strive to be a bright place in their lives."

Lekotek Ambassadors are actively encouraging attendance and tickets are $90 per person. Corporate sponsors and donors are gratefully accepted. Co-chairman of Lekotek Ambassador Group, Carrie Grady adds, "Bringing awareness to an organization that works to better the lives of children and families has been extremely rewarding and our success in fundraising in a short period of time is a true testament to what can be accomplished when people work together for a common good."
